The Projection for the Future

Given the industry’s current rapid growth, we can expect the power of social media marketing sector to keep on climbing. It’s projected that by 2027, this industry could be worth a massive $434 billion. This robust growth clearly shows how important social media has become in the world of marketing.

Companies now depend on these platforms more than ever to connect with their audiences and market their products effectively. In short, social media marketing is on a path to an even more impressive future.

With this rapid growth trajectory, it’s anticipated that the power of social media marketing industry will continue its ascent, reaching an estimated market cap of $434 billion by 2027. This growth is a testament to the pivotal role social media plays in modern marketing and the increasing reliance of companies on these platforms to reach and engage their audiences effectively.

Here are a few other social media marketing statistics to consider, regarding the percentage of consumers who report finding products through various forms of social media engagement:

  • Targeted ads: 49%
  • Organic posts from brands: 40%
  • Social media research: 34%
  • Seeing a friend’s post: 34%
  • Tags and DMs: 22%

The Path to Prosperous Remuneration

Once you’ve honed your digital marketing skills, an array of opportunities awaits you, especially for those who are starting their journey. The standard trajectory often begins with internships, which provide essential industry exposure and experience.

Graduates embarking on their careers in digital marketing can initially expect to earn approximately INR 25,000 per month. This practical experience serves as a stepping stone, guiding them towards the significant milestone of earning INR 1 lakh per month, which becomes a feasible target after accumulating 3 to 4 years of expertise in this dynamic field.

power of social media marketing

Moreover, it’s important to highlight the various factors influencing your earning potential in digital marketing:

Skills and Expertise: Proficiency in diverse areas such as SEO, content marketing, social media management, and data analytics often translates to higher earning potential.

Geographical Location: Earnings can vary substantially based on the region in which you work. Metropolitans often offer higher salaries due to a higher cost of living.

Company Size and Reputation: Established companies and recognized brands typically offer more competitive compensation packages.

Specialization: Specialized roles such as ecommerce SEO specialists, content strategists, or data analysts often command higher salaries than generalist positions.

Certifications: Acquiring certifications from reputable institutions can boost your credibility and potentially lead to higher-paying job offers or freelancing opportunities.

Negotiation Skills: Your ability to negotiate your compensation package during job offers or freelance contracts can significantly impact your income. Remember, while attractive salaries are possible, they come with dedication, continuous learning, and the willingness to adapt to the ever-changing landscape of digital marketing.
